An opportunity in our Growth/Corporate Development team has opened for a seasoned Senior Growth Analyst to propel our growth strategies, particularly through greenfield expansion, mergers and acquisitions, new ventures, and enhancing our product line. Reporting directly to the Chief Growth Officer, you will work closely with cross-functional teams, including marketing, sales, product development, and finance, to leverage opportunities for growth, and design and execute strategies to optimize our performance.

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Growth Strategy Development: Collaborate with senior leadership to define and execute growth strategies and develop plans to capitalize on them through:
  • Greenfield Development: Identify and assess opportunities for new market entries and greenfield developments. Develop and execute plans to establish a presence in new geographic areas and increase market penetration in existing markets.
  • Mergers & Acquisitions: Identify, evaluate, and support the execution of potential M&A opportunities to drive growth. Perform due diligence and financial analysis to assess the viability and strategic fit of targets.
  • Product Add-Ons: Evaluate opportunities for new product introductions and enhancements. Collaborate with product development teams to drive product innovation and expansion.
  • Performance Optimization: Monitor and analyze the performance of growth initiatives. Use data to create actionable plans for improvement and to optimize processes and strategies.
  • Data Analysis & Insights: Analyze large datasets to extract actionable insights that drive growth strategies. Develop and maintain dashboards and reports to track key performance indicators (KPIs).
  • Market Research: Conduct market research to find trends, understand the competitive landscape, and opportunities for growth. Provide recommendations based on market dynamics and company objectives.
  • Financial Modeling: Develop financial models to forecast growth scenarios, measure ROI, and support strategic decision-making.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with marketing, sales, operations, and finance teams to align growth initiatives with company goals. Provide analytical support and recommendations.
  • Reporting & Communication: Prepare and present detailed reports and presentations to senior management. Clearly communicate findings, insights, and recommendations to stakeholders.
  •  Continuous Improvement: Stay up to date with industry trends, best practices, and emerging technologies. Continuously seek ways to improve processes and methodologies.
